The screenplay, based on an original story by Patel, was co-written with Paul Angunawela and John Collee. Initially planned for a Netflix release, the film’s transition to a theatrical debut is facilitated through Universal’s agreement with Monkeypaw Productions.

In addition to Patel and Peele, the production team includes producers Jomon Thomas, Win Rosenfeld, Ian Cooper, Basil Iwanyk, Erica Lee, Christine Haebler, and Anjay Nagpal. Executive producers on the project are Jonathan Fuhrman, Natalya Pavchinskaya, Aaron L. Gilbert, Andria Spring, Alison-Jane Roney, and Steven Thibault.
